Firefox no longer works with Amazon Prime video

darweb2 отвечено
darweb2

Firefox was just updated to version 91.0.2 (64 bit), and now the l;inks on Amazon Prime video no longer work. Many of the links take me to my Watchlist. I tried accessing the site using Chrome and Edge - no problems with those browsers. Firefox was working with Amazon last night, so this is something that happened with the recent update.

Make sure you are not blocking content.

Diagnose Firefox issues using Troubleshoot(Safe) Mode {web link}

A small dialog should appear. Click Start In Troubleshoot(Safe) Mode (not Refresh). Is the problem still there?


https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/enhanced-tracking-protection-firefox-desktop


Many site issues can be caused by corrupt cookies or cache.

Warning ! ! This will log you out of sites you're logged in to. You may also lose any settings for that website.

You can check the Web Console for media related messages.
